A maintainer of containerd, Lima, Moby(dockerd), BuildKit, runc, etc.
-
NTT
- Tokyo, Japan
-
05:11
(UTC +09:00) - @_AkihiroSuda_
- @AkihiroSuda@mastodon.social
- https://medium.com/@AkihiroSuda
Highlights
Block or Report
Block or report AkihiroSuda
Report abuse
Contact GitHub support about this user’s behavior. Learn more about reporting abuse.
Report abusePinned
4,978 contributions in the last year
Less
More
Activity overview
Contribution activity
May 2023
Created 213 commits in 24 repositories
Created 1 repository
Created a pull request in opencontainers/runtime-spec that received 21 comments
MAINTAINERS: add Toru Komatsu (utam0k)
@utam0k is a maintainer of youki and has been actively contributing to the spec: https://github.com/search?q=repo%3Aopencontainers%2Fruntime-spec+…
+1
−0
•
21
comments
Opened 60 other pull requests in 15 repositories
lima-vm/lima
12
merged
1
open
2
closed
-
vz: silence
Ignoring: vmType vz: [CPUType]when the value is empty - vz: fail early when arch is invalid
-
Mark
limactl snapshotexperimental -
Debug
ssh.servicefailure -
Silence "
audio.deviceis experimental" warn when audio is unused - CI: add colima compatibility test
-
Mark
audio.deviceexperimental - nerdctl: update to v1.4.0
- templates: update Nomad to v0.9.4; link net-user-v2 from README
- templates: update AlmaLinux and Rocky Linux to 9.2; update Ubuntu to 23.04; update CentOS Stream, Arch Linux, Debian
- docs/talks.md: update
- CI: replace Wine with Windows
- go.mod: bump up go-qemu, tcpproxy, k8s.io, golang.org/x, etc.
- templates: use yq's indentation style
- CI: run integration tests with macos-13
lima-vm/go-qcow2reader
10
merged
AkihiroSuda/myaot
8
merged
containerd/nerdctl
6
merged
1
closed
- nerdctl system prune: skip pruning build cache if buildkit is not running
-
Silence
WARN[0000] failed to get unpacked size of image - nerdctl images: Remove TODOs about VirtualSize
- CI: update containerd (1.7.1)
- test-integration-docker-compatibility: attempt to deflake TestUniqueHostPortAssignment
- update containerd (1.7.1), CNI plugins (1.3.0), BuildKit (0.11.6), Kubo (0.20.0), containerd-fuse-overlayfs (1.0.6), fuse-overlayfs (1.1.2)
- go.mod: github.com/opencontainers/image-spec v1.1.0-rc3
containerd/containerd
6
merged
1
open
- go.mod: github.com/containerd/continuity v0.4.0
- go.mod: github.com/containerd/go-runc v1.1.0
- [release/1.7 backport] snapshots/testsuite: Rename: fix fuse-overlayfs incompatibility
- api/services/task: add RuntimeInfo()
- snapshots/testsuite: Rename: fix fuse-overlayfs incompatibility
- go.mod: github.com/opencontainers/runtime-spec v1.1.0-rc.2
- go.mod: github.com/opencontainers/image-spec v1.1.0-rc3
opencontainers/runtime-spec
2
open
2
merged
containers/gvisor-tap-vsock
1
open
lima-vm/alpine-lima
1
merged
rootless-containers/usernetes
1
merged
containerd/fuse-overlayfs-snapshotter
1
merged
containerd/go-runc
1
merged
opencontainers/runc
1
open
Mirantis/cri-dockerd
1
merged
containerd/nydus-snapshotter
1
merged
containerd/stargz-snapshotter
1
open
Reviewed 172 pull requests in 26 repositories
lima-vm/lima
25 pull requests
- Bump alpine to 0.2.30 and fix Rosetta support
- [examples/k8s.yaml] the url to get gpg key for kubernetes is moved
- [examples/k8s.yaml] the url to get gpg key for kubernetes is moved
- vz: fail early when arch is invalid
- Add audio input to qemu in order to match vz
- Update the network interfaces after snapshot load
- build(deps): bump github.com/mikefarah/yq/v4 from 4.33.3 to 4.34.1
- Alpine 3.18 on VZ requires macOS 13.3+
- build(deps): bump github.com/mattn/go-isatty from 0.0.18 to 0.0.19
- CI: add colima compatibility test
- Bump alpine from 3.17 → 3.18
- build(deps): bump github.com/containerd/continuity from 0.4.0 to 0.4.1
- Fix unstable vz driver network issue
- Make cache pruning more flexible
- Implement the snapshot commands
- build(deps): bump github.com/sirupsen/logrus from 1.9.1 to 1.9.2
- vz: validate required version before hostagent start
- build(deps): bump github.com/containerd/continuity from 0.3.0 to 0.4.0
- build(deps): bump github.com/sirupsen/logrus from 1.9.0 to 1.9.1
- Check qemu version in hostagent so not too old
- add "dependency" provisioning mode
- Include manpages for lima and limactl commands
- Support audio device for vz driver
- build(deps): bump github.com/containerd/containerd from 1.7.0 to 1.7.1
- Add audio device to limayaml and qemu
- Some pull request reviews not shown.
containerd/nerdctl
25 pull requests
- build(deps): bump github.com/mattn/go-isatty from 0.0.18 to 0.0.19
- build(deps): bump github.com/containerd/nydus-snapshotter from 0.8.1 to 0.8.2
- build(deps): bump github.com/docker/cli from 24.0.0+incompatible to 24.0.1+incompatible
- build(deps): bump github.com/docker/docker from 24.0.0+incompatible to 24.0.1+incompatible
- build(deps): bump github.com/containerd/continuity from 0.4.0 to 0.4.1
- build(deps): bump github.com/sirupsen/logrus from 1.9.1 to 1.9.2
- build(deps): bump github.com/containerd/continuity from 0.3.0 to 0.4.0
- build(deps): bump github.com/containerd/nydus-snapshotter from 0.8.0 to 0.8.1
- build(deps): bump github.com/compose-spec/compose-go from 1.13.4 to 1.13.5
- build(deps): bump github.com/sirupsen/logrus from 1.9.0 to 1.9.1
- build(deps): bump github.com/containerd/accelerated-container-image from 0.6.3 to 0.6.4
- test-integration-docker-compatibility: attempt to deflake TestUniqueHostPortAssignment
-
[WIP] Support
container export - build(deps): bump github.com/containerd/accelerated-container-image from 0.6.2 to 0.6.3
- build(deps): bump github.com/containerd/containerd from 1.7.0 to 1.7.1
- build(deps): bump golang.org/x/crypto from 0.8.0 to 0.9.0
- build(deps): bump github.com/containerd/typeurl/v2 from 2.1.0 to 2.1.1
- CI: Add check for go mod tidy
- build(deps): bump github.com/docker/cli from 23.0.5+incompatible to 23.0.6+incompatible
- Update Windows tests to use the check HyperV helper
- build(deps): bump golang.org/x/net from 0.9.0 to 0.10.0
- build(deps): bump github.com/docker/docker from 23.0.5+incompatible to 23.0.6+incompatible
- [Refactor] Refactor the (container) create command flagging process
- Add Windows tests for the container commands
- build(deps): bump github.com/Microsoft/hcsshim from 0.10.0-rc.7 to 0.10.0-rc.8
- Some pull request reviews not shown.
moby/moby
22 pull requests
- vendor: github.com/mistifyio/go-zfs/v3 v3.0.1
- vendor: github.com/moby/buildkit v0.11.7-0.20230525183624-798ad6b0ce9f
- [24.0 backport] vendor: github.com/moby/buildkit v0.11.7-0.20230525183624-798ad6b0ce9f
- vendor: github.com/spf13/cobra v1.7.0
- Fail unpacking images with xattrs to filesystems without xattr support
- API: omit deprecated VirtualSize field for API v1.44 and up
- [24.0 backport] c8d: The authorizer needs to be set even if AuthConfig is empty
- Fixing dockerd-rootless-setuptools.sh when user name contains a backslash
- Revert "Updated outdated docker contributing guidelines link"
- [builder] make chownComment easy to read
- remove deprecated types, fields, and functions
- libnetwork: update example in README.md
- [23.0 backport] vendor: github.com/docker/distribution v2.8.2
- Support recursively read-only (RRO) mounts
- [20.10 backport] Jenkinsfile: use Ubuntu 20.04
- [20.10 backport] update runc binary to v1.1.7
- vendor: github.com/docker/distribution v2.8.2
- Do not drop effective&permitted set
- [20.10] update containerd binary to v1.6.21
- Allow for xattr copy failure for vfs
- vendor: github.com/opencontainers/runtime-spec v1.1.0-rc.2
- vendor: github.com/moby/term v0.5.0
opencontainers/runc
18 pull requests
- [1.1] libct: fix a race with systemd removal
- Fix Vagrant caching
- [1.1] init: do not print environment variable value
- runc kill: add support for cgroup.kill
- Better hooks errors and more tests
- tests/int: increase num retries for oom tests
- build(deps): bump github.com/sirupsen/logrus from 1.9.0 to 1.9.2
- build(deps): bump github.com/sirupsen/logrus from 1.9.0 to 1.9.1
- build(deps): bump tim-actions/get-pr-commits from 1.2.0 to 1.3.0
- Some init code refactoring
- ci/gha: cross-i386: fix build, rm kludges
- Intel RDT: updates according to proposed spec changes.
- libct/cg/sd: use systemd v240+ new MAJOR:* syntax
- go.mod: runtime-spec v1.1.0-rc.2
- [Carry #3205] libct/cg: add CFS bandwidth burst for CPU
- build(deps): bump golang.org/x/net from 0.9.0 to 0.10.0
- Refactor mountFd code
- build(deps): bump golang.org/x/sys from 0.7.0 to 0.8.0
containerd/containerd
15 pull requests
- Document Protocol Buffer Setup
- use consistent alias for OCI image spec
- fix: cio.Cancel() should close the pipes
- Add blockfile snapshotter
- api/services/task: add RuntimeInfo()
- Bump seccomp version to be the same as one in runc repo
- Add a Mount manager for containerd (Issue #8347)
- CRI: Support Linux username for !linux platforms
-
runtime/shim: rename RunManager to Run and remove
runc/v2/servicespackage - Update getting-started.md
- [release/1.7] Update ttrpc v1.2.2
- [release/1.7] Prepare release notes for v1.7.1
- [release/1.7] bump typeurl to v2.1.1
- Bump up golangci-lint to v1.52.2
- Add faasd and actuated into the ADOPTERS file
moby/buildkit
15 pull requests
- vendor: fix broken vendoring
- dockerfile: bump up nerdctl to v1.4.0
- vendor: github.com/docker/docker and github.com/docker/cli v24.0.1
- vendor: github.com/containerd/containerd v1.7.1
- [0.11] vendor: github.com/containerd/containerd v1.6.21
- Support for building overlaybd images
- vendor: github.com/spdx/tools-golang v0.5.0
- Dockerfile: update runc v1.1.7, containerd v1.6.21, v1.7.1
- vendor: github.com/docker/docker, github.com/docker/cli v24.0.0
- Add resource usage monitoring for build steps
- build(deps): bump github.com/docker/distribution from 2.8.1+incompatible to 2.8.2+incompatible
- control: fix possible deadlock on network error
- vendor: github.com/opencontainers/image-spec v1.1.0-rc3
- vendor: github.com/docker/docker, github.com/docker/cli v23.0.5
- test: use appropriate snapshotter service to walk snapshots
norouter/norouter
7 pull requests
- build(deps): bump github.com/sirupsen/logrus from 1.9.0 to 1.9.2
- build(deps): bump github.com/mattn/go-isatty from 0.0.18 to 0.0.19
- build(deps): bump golang.org/x/sync from 0.1.0 to 0.2.0
- build(deps): bump github.com/cybozu-go/usocksd from 1.2.0 to 1.3.0
- build(deps): bump github.com/goccy/go-yaml from 1.10.0 to 1.11.0
- build(deps): bump github.com/miekg/dns from 1.1.52 to 1.1.54
- build(deps): bump github.com/urfave/cli/v2 from 2.25.1 to 2.25.3
reproducible-containers/repro-get
5 pull requests
- build(deps): bump github.com/mattn/go-isatty from 0.0.18 to 0.0.19
- build(deps): bump github.com/containerd/nerdctl from 1.3.1 to 1.4.0
- build(deps): bump github.com/sirupsen/logrus from 1.9.0 to 1.9.2
- build(deps): bump github.com/containerd/containerd from 1.7.0 to 1.7.1
- build(deps): bump golang from 1.20.3-bullseye to 1.20.4-bullseye
opencontainers/runtime-spec
4 pull requests
containerd/stargz-snapshotter
4 pull requests
containerd/continuity
3 pull requests
rootless-containers/rootlesskit
3 pull requests
lima-vm/sshocker
3 pull requests
containerd/zfs
2 pull requests
docker/buildx
2 pull requests
opencontainers/image-spec
2 pull requests
containerd/console
1 pull request
kubernetes/enhancements
1 pull request
docker/go-units
1 pull request
containers/fuse-overlayfs
1 pull request
krallin/tini
1 pull request
containerd/cgroups
1 pull request
rootless-containers/rootlesscontaine.rs
1 pull request
docker/docker-install
1 pull request
containerd/accelerated-container-image
1 pull request
1
repository not shown
Created an issue in lima-vm/lima that received 11 comments
[Ubuntu 23.04, Fedora 38] limactl start --set '.vmType = "vz"' crashes: "usernet unable to resolve IP for SSH forwarding"
EDIT This seems to be a regression in kernel 6.2, reported to https://bugzilla.kernel.org/show_bug.cgi?id=217485 $ limactl start --set '.vmType = …
11
comments
Opened 15 other issues in 7 repositories
lima-vm/lima
5
open
1
closed
- v0.16 planning
-
./hack/test-example.sh ./examples/default.yamlhangs onSending HMP loadvm command -
Add
user-v2tonetworks.yamlautomatically (when upgraded from Lima < 0.16) -
Flaky test:
Job for ssh.service failed because the control process exited with error code. -
Rename
/usr/local/share/lima/examplesto/usr/local/share/lima/templates - vz: fail before running hostagent when macOS is too old
AkihiroSuda/myaot
2
open
1
closed
opencontainers/runc
2
open
containerd/nerdctl
1
closed
opencontainers/runtime-spec
1
open
lima-vm/go-qcow2reader
1
closed
Answered 1 discussion in 1 repository
lima-vm/lima
lima-vm/lima
-
Intel-on-ARM emulation fails with error "vz driver state stopped"
This contribution was made on May 24






